Bhadora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Bhadora Village has a population of 928 (928) with 463 (463) males and 465 (465) females.The sex ratio in Bhadora is 1005, indicating an above-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Bhadora Village is 118 (118) which is 12.72% of Bhadora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Bhadora Village is 816 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Bhadora village is listed as part of the Malkharoda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Janjgir - Champa District in the state of CHHATTISGARH in INDIA.
The majority of the Village population resides in Rural areas.

Bhadora Literacy Rate
Bhadora Village has a literacy rate of 68.27%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Bhadora Village is 81.66 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Bhadora Village is 55.34 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Bhadora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Bhadora Village is 156 (156) with 83 (83) males and 73 (73) females, which is 16.81% of Bhadora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 880 females for every 1000 males.
Bhadora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es(ST) Population in Bhadora Village is 182 (182) with 89 (89) males and 93 (93) females, which is 19.61% of Bhadora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Tribes is 1045 females for every 1000 males.
